Description
Anaerobic Natural Sidra by Luis Anibal Calderón, Villa Betulia, Colombia. Produced at Villa Betulia in Huila, Colombia, this lot underwent an anaerobic fermentation before being dried as a natural process. The result is a coffee with deep fruit character, lifted florals and a dense, almost silk-like sweetness that carries through the entire cup. This Sidra by Luis Anibal Calderon sits somewhere in between deeply aromatic and layered, yet remarkably precise in structure.
